SEPI (Sociedad Estatal de Participaciones Industriales) is a Spanish state-owned industrial holding company. It is currently newsworthy due to investigations into its financial decisions, particularly regarding the rescue of companies like Plus Ultra and Air Europa. Belén Gualda, the president of SEPI, has testified before the Senate, denying any undue influence from political figures in these decisions and defending the "solvency" of Plus Ultra, despite its limited repayment of funds. SEPI is also a major shareholder in Indra, a strategic technology and defense company. Recent events include the forced resignation of Indra's president, Ángel Escribano, reportedly due to clashes with SEPI, and the subsequent government interest in a merger between Indra and Escribano Mechanical & Engineering (EM&E). The potential acquisition of EM&E by the German military giant Rheinmetall is also under government review. SEPI's role in these events highlights its significant influence in the Spanish economy and defense sector.
